Ummm....Flame isn't a Brown-Red. Brown reds do not have red or brown color in the wing bay (exposed portion of secondaries when wing is folded)/ the triangle at the bottom of his wing. He looks exactly like the wheaten male lacking a few "particulars". His beard is gorgeous! Nice and black which is rare.
